QUOTE(ahhann @ Nov 19 2012, 11:55 AM)
For surfmore50, since it don't free any talk time at all, i was wondering how the voice plan was billed?

a) Monthly commitment RM50 cover 2G data and voice bill call up to RM50 per RM0.12/min ?

b) Monthly commitment RM50 for data only. Voice usage as individual bill. Mean monthly RM50 (data) + RMxx (voice) RM0.12/min ?

Which scenario is it? a) or b)?
*
B. Pay as-you-use rates, the credit limit for voice call and SMS should be RM250 (default).

You can decrease or increase the credit limit accordingly.

The data should be 3G not 2G.
